Replacement and Structure of S-Boxes in Rijndael
暂无分享,去创建一个
This paper describes the designation and structure of S-boxes which are the fundament of the Rijndael algorithm and finds the optimization of them using four kinds of testing methods. Firstly, it constructs different S-boxes by Matlab using 30 irreducible polynomials the maximum power of which is eight in a finite field. Through taking their performance analysis, we find that they have the similar performances in differential testing and linear or correlation testing. But in avalanche testing and Boolean expressions testing, the S-boxes which are constructed by No. 9 and No. 18 irreducible polynomial are optimal structure respectively.
[1] Vincent Leith,et al. The Rijndael Block Cipher , 2010 .
[2] Yunghsiang S. Han. Introduction to Finite Fields , 2007 .
[3] William Hugh Murray,et al. Modern Cryptography , 1995, Information Security Journal.